Promote responsible behaviour on public transport
Our story
Pupils are given specific instructions about travelling on public transport when they are on trips using public transport (see other activity). Teachers instruct the boys to be considerate to others and supervise pupils to ensure this instruction is understood and followed. The need for responsible behaviour on public transport is considered as part of the risk assessments for these specific trips.
More generally, all boys have an 'Expectations and Behaviour' document which forms part of their school diary/ log book. This includes a section on being 'out and about', including on public transport. The guidance given includes "being aware of those around you at all times and remember you are representing your school' and also to thank drivers at the end of a trip.
